Top 3 Best Selma Public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 3 public schools serving 1,872 students in Selma, NC.
The top ranked public schools in Selma, NC are Selma Elementary School and Selma Middle School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Selma, NC public schools have an average math proficiency score of 21% (versus the North Carolina public school average of 42%), and reading proficiency score of 19% (versus the 47% statewide average). Schools in Selma have an average ranking of 1/10, which is in the bottom 50% of North Carolina public schools.
Minority enrollment is 73%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the North Carolina public school average of 55% (majority Black).
